A Study on Agricultural Infrastructure in Potato Cultivation with Reference to Chikkamagaluru District

Author(s) KAVYA R, PRUTHVIRAJ T D, Dr. SHOBHARANI.H
Country India
Abstract Infrastructure plays a vital role in agriculture at every single step such as supply of inputs, sowing of crops and for post harvest management. Investment on infrastructural practices in agriculture must be in a planned manner to avoid post harvest losses and enhances productivity. India is lacking with infrastructure up gradation with respect to storage houses, pack houses, absence of proper supply chain for agricultural inputs. However, the present study has been undertaken to analyze agricultural infrastructure in potato cultivation. The study focuses on to study the impact of infrastructure development in potato cultivation, to study the present condition of agricultural infrastructure in potato cultivation, to evaluate farmer’s satisfaction towards agricultural infrastructure. The data for the present study has been collected by meeting 50 potato cultivators from Chikkamagaluru district with the help of structured questionnaire. It was found that majority of the potato cultivator prefer resource based infrastructure development and strongly agree that agricultural infrastructure leads to high yield.
